CLASS SECTIONS:
Class 1 & 2: INTRO CLASSES
Restricted to non-BD & BE members (excluding BD associate members) who have not been placed 1st or 2nd in a prelim class at Bury Farm (horse and rider combination.) Can be ridden in any preferred tack. BD/BE members may enter the class in the Open Section

Class 3, 4, 5 & 6: PRELIM & NOVICE SECTIONS
Restricted Prelim - Restricted to non-BD/BE members (excluding BD associate members) who have not won 3 tests at prelim or above at Bury Farm (horse and rider combination.) Horses and riders must not be fully registered with BD/BS or BE.
Restricted Novice - Restricted to horse and rider combinations who have no points at novice level or above or who have not won 3 tests or more at novice level or above at Bury Farm (horse and rider combination.) Horses and riders must not be fully registered with BD/BS or BE. 

Open Prelim and Novice - Open to all
***Horse and Rider Combinations that have previously won a BFEC Unaffiliated Dressage Championship class can still compete at the same level but they must compete in the Open section***

Class 7: Open to all
Class 8: All tests are to be long arena 60x20m current BD, BE or BRC tests

BIOSECURITY MEASURES

All horses must be travelled with passports which can demonstrate that all vaccinations are up to date (Bury Farm operates a 12-month vaccination policy)

Horses must also show no clinical signs of the following when attending the centre:

  1. recent cough of unknown cause
  2. recent nasal discharge of unknown cause
  3. enlarged lymph nodes
  4. fever (>38.5 degrees)
  5. recent onset of neurological signs of unknown cause
  6. diarrhoea

Horses must also 

  1. not be under current investigation for EHV infection
  2. have not been in contact with and is not kept on the same premises as a horse known to have or be under investigation for EHV
  3. have not travelled out of the country for the past 28 days.

 Horses should NOT be brought to the centre if they are not in good health on the date of travel.
